HK Army HSTL Harness: An Affordable Strapped Pod Pack

The HK Army HSTL Harness is an affordable paintball pod pack designed for players who prefer the security and familiarity of traditional pod straps. Its lightweight construction, high-density panels, tough-grip closures, and adjustable waistband help keep the harness stable while running, sliding, and moving between bunkers.

Unlike strapless harnesses that rely on adjustable compression, the HSTL uses individual closures to keep the primary pods secured until they are needed. Additional elastic pod loops allow players to carry extra paint without making the harness unnecessarily bulky during shorter games.

The HSTL is a practical choice for newer players, recreational paintball, scenario games, and anyone who wants dependable pod retention at an accessible price. Players who prioritize straightforward operation over premium magnetic or strapless technology can shop the HK Army HSTL Harness in the available colors and configurations.

Who Is the HK Army HSTL Harness Best For?

The HSTL is best suited to players who want an affordable, lightweight, and easy-to-use paintball harness with traditional strapped pod retention. It provides a dependable starting point for newer players while still offering the stability and capacity needed for regular recreational play.

HK Army Eject-X Harness: Fast Pod Access and Secure Retention

The HK Army Eject-X Harness is a premium strapped paintball pod pack designed for players who want secure pod retention without sacrificing reload speed. Its Stealth Ejector system uses four-way elastic pod caps that help push each pod forward when the closure is released, making pods easier to grab during fast points.

After a pod is removed, the ejector retracts into the padded holster to maintain a clean, low-profile shape. The padded pod caps also help protect the tops of the pods from direct impacts, while textured elastic holsters hold their shape and keep the remaining pods secure.

The Eject-X uses HK Army’s X-Frame construction, multiple adjustable tension belts, anti-slip lumbar padding, and additional elastic pod loops to reduce movement while carrying extra paint. It is also compatible with the HK Army Op-Link system found on select Proline pants for players who want additional stability and weight distribution.

What Makes the HK Army Eject-X Harness Different?

The Eject-X combines the security of a traditional strapped harness with an active pod-ejection system. It is best suited to competitive and aggressive players who want their pods firmly secured while running and diving, but still need fast access when it is time to reload.

HK Army Magtek Harness: Magnetic Pod Retention

The HK Army Magtek Harness is a premium strapped paintball pod pack that uses magnetic closures instead of standard hook-and-loop pod straps. Four magnets in each primary holster help keep the pods secured while allowing the closure to release quickly when the player needs to reload.

The magnetic closures are paired with HK Army’s Stealth Ejector system, which helps move the pod forward after the strap is opened. Once the pod is removed, the ejector retracts into the padded holster to preserve the harness’s streamlined profile. Reinforced elastic loops provide additional carrying capacity when more paint is needed.

Anatomically shaped back padding flexes with the player’s movement, while the woven belt system and anti-slip lumbar support help reduce shifting and bounce. This combination makes the Magtek a strong option for players who want traditional strapped retention with a more advanced closure system.

How Does the HK Army Magtek Harness Work?

Each primary pod holster uses four magnets to secure its padded closure. When the player opens the closure, the Stealth Ejector system helps present the pod for faster access. The Magtek is best suited to players who prefer strapped pod security but want an alternative to conventional hook-and-loop closures.

HK Army Zero-G Harnesses: Strapless Speed and Adjustable Retention

HK Army Zero-G harnesses use adjustable strapless holsters to secure pods without individual pod closures. This design gives players direct access to their pods while keeping the harness compact and streamlined. Each holster uses HK Army’s Tension Control system, allowing players to adjust the internal elastic retention for the size and style of pod they use.

The HK Army Zero G Lite provides the most affordable entry into the Zero-G strapless system. It combines adjustable pod retention with lightweight foam holsters, an adjustable waistband, and removable anti-slip lumbar padding.

The HK Army Zero G 2.0 adds membrane compression inside the holsters, built-in hip protection, flexible back padding, and several carrying configurations. It provides a middle option for players who want more support and capacity without moving to the premium Zero-GX.

The HK Army Zero-GX is the most advanced option in the family. Its X-Frame construction, four-part belt system, adjustable body padding, and exterior compression belt are designed to minimize harness movement and reduce its profile as pods are removed.

Which HK Army Zero-G Harness Should I Choose?

  • Choose the Zero G Lite for an affordable, lightweight strapless harness.
  • Choose the Zero G 2.0 for additional padding, compression, and carrying capacity.
  • Choose the Zero-GX for the most adjustable fit, advanced belt construction, and maximum harness stability.

HK Army Paintball Pods, Pod Cleaners and Ball Haulers

A paintball harness works best when it is paired with dependable pods that match the player’s preferred capacity and reloading style. HK Army offers standard and high-capacity pods, cleaning tools, and paint-storage accessories that support players both on the field and in the staging area.

HK Army MaxLock Pods hold up to 185 paintballs and use a spring-loaded push-button lid. The locking design helps prevent accidental spills, while the anti-slip grip makes the pod easier to hold during fast reloads. Players who want a more traditional pod can choose HK Army Skull Pods, which hold approximately 150 paintballs and feature a spring-loaded lid, enlarged thumb groove, and contoured shape.

Broken paint, dirt, and debris inside a pod can contaminate fresh paintballs and cause loader problems. The HK Army Mist Pod Swab combines a removable microfiber swab with a built-in spray bottle, allowing players to clean their pods at the field. An included carabiner makes it easy to attach the swab to a gear bag or backpack.

The HK Army Reload Ball Hauler stores up to 1,000 paintballs and uses separate locking openings for loading and pouring. Volume markings help players monitor the amount of paint remaining, while the included eight-size ball sizer can be used to compare paintball and barrel bore sizes.

Which HK Army Pod or Accessory Should I Choose?

  • Choose MaxLock Pods for increased capacity and a push-button locking lid.
  • Choose Skull Pods for a simple 150-round high-capacity pod.
  • Choose the Mist Pod Swab for cleaning broken paint and debris from inside pods.
  • Choose the Reload Ball Hauler for storing paint and filling pods in the staging area.

HK Army Paintball Harness Frequently Asked Questions

What is the difference between a strapped and strapless paintball harness?

A strapped harness uses individual closures over the primary pods to keep them secured. A strapless harness uses elastic compression to hold each pod without a separate closure. Strapped harnesses provide familiar and dependable retention, while strapless harnesses provide faster access when properly adjusted. Neither design is automatically better; the right choice depends on the player’s preferred balance of security and reload speed.

What do harness sizes such as 3+2 and 3+2+4 mean?

The first number identifies the number of primary pod holsters. The additional numbers identify extra elastic pod loops. A 3+2 harness carries three pods in the primary holsters and two additional pods in elastic loops. On an HK Army 3+2+4 harness, three pods fit in the primary holsters, with two additional inner loops and four exterior loops for increased carrying capacity.

Do all paintball pods fit HK Army harnesses?

Most standard paintball pods fit HK Army harnesses. Zero-G strapless harnesses include adjustable Tension Control systems that can be set for different pod sizes and shapes. Traditional strapped harnesses can also accommodate many standard and high-capacity pods. Always test every pod in the harness before playing to make sure it is secure but still easy to remove.

How should a paintball harness fit?

A paintball harness should sit securely across the lower back and hips without restricting movement or breathing. Tighten the waistband enough to minimize bouncing while running, sliding, or diving, but not so tightly that it becomes uncomfortable. Make final adjustments while the harness is loaded because the weight of full pods can change how it feels and moves.

Which HK Army harness is best for a beginner?

The HK Army HSTL is a strong choice for beginners who want an affordable and straightforward strapped harness. Players who prefer a faster strapless system can consider the HK Army Zero G Lite. The best beginner harness should fit comfortably, remain stable when loaded, and provide enough capacity for the player’s normal style of play.

How should I clean paintball pods and a harness?

Remove all pods and loose paint before cleaning. Wipe the harness with a damp cloth and allow it to air-dry completely before storage. Pods should be cleaned whenever they contain broken paint, dirt, or debris. The HK Army Mist Pod Swab combines a microfiber swab with a built-in spray bottle for cleaning the inside of paintball pods at home or at the field.
